The Confinement Effect: Home Imprisonment's Toll on Families
Home confinement, a sentence that restricts individuals to their residences, can have profound effects on families. While intended as an alternative to traditional incarceration, its presence often generates significant tension. The constant knowledge of a loved one's confinement can burden heavily on family members, leading to emotional and material challenges. Moreover, the lack of physical presence frequently disrupts familial connections.
- Youngsters may struggle with feelings of confusion due to their parent's absence.
- Loved Ones often carry the weight of household responsibilities and emotional guidance, facing increased obligations.
- Families may face hardships in maintaining a sense of normalcy, as daily routines are modified by the presence of confinement.

Electronic Monitoring: A Double-Edged Sword for Home Confinement
Electronic monitoring offers a unique approach to home confinement, allowing individuals to complete their sentences in the comfort of their own homes. While this approach offers opportunities for reintegration, it also presents challenges. Privacy becomes a pressing issue as individuals' movements are constantly tracked. The ever-present gaze of electronic monitoring can hinder an individual's ability to reintegrate back into society, leading to alienation. Furthermore, the technology itself can be unreliable, raising questions about its dependability in ensuring compliance. Ultimately, the success of electronic monitoring hinges on finding a balance between restraint and the protection of individual rights.
